DECISION & ORDER ON MOTION

Motion by Kevin Street for leave to appeal to this Court from two orders of the Family Court, Kings County, both dated November 21, 2019, to stay enforcement of the orders pending hearing and determination of the appeals, for poor person relief, and for the assignment of counsel.

Upon the papers filed in support of the motion and the papers filed in opposition and in relation thereto, it is

ORDERED that the motion is granted; and it is further,

ORDERED that enforcement of the orders is stayed either pending hearing and determination of the appeals or issuance of a dispositional order determining the above-referenced proceedings, whichever occurs first; and it is further,

ORDERED that the appeals will be heard on the original papers (including a certified transcript of the proceedings, if any) and on the briefs of the parties who are directed to file an original and five duplicate hard copies, and, if represented by counsel, one digital copy, of their respective briefs, and to serve one hard copy on each other (22 NYCRR 1250.5[e][1], 1250.9[a][4],[c][1],[d],[e]; Family Ct Act § 1116); and it is further,

ORDERED that the stenographer(s) and/or the transcription service(s) is/are required promptly to make and certify two transcripts of the proceedings, if any, except for those minutes previously transcribed and certified; in the case of stenographers, both transcripts shall be filed with the clerk of the Family Court, and the clerk of the Family Court shall furnish one of such certified transcripts to the appellant's counsel, without charge; in the case of transcription services, one transcript shall be filed with the clerk of the Family Court and one transcript shall be delivered to the assigned counsel. Assigned counsel is directed to provide copies of said transcripts to all of the other parties to the appeals, including the attorney for the child, if any, when counsel serves the appellant's brief upon those parties; and it is further,

ORDERED that pursuant to Family Court Act § 1120 the following named attorney is assigned as counsel to prosecute the appeals:

and it is further,

ORDERED that the assigned counsel shall prosecute the appeals expeditiously in accordance with any scheduling order or orders issued pursuant to 670.3(b) of the rules of this Court (22 NYCRR 670.3[b]); and it is further,

ORDERED that assigned counsel is directed to serve a copy of this decision and order on motion upon the clerk of the court from which the appeals are taken.
